A potential tumor suppressor role of PLK2 in glioblastoma

open access: yesFEBS Open Bio, EarlyView.
PLK2 was consistently downregulated in GBM tissues. Overexpression of PLK2 in GBM cell lines U87MG and U251 reduced their tumorigenic potential and enhanced cell cycle arrest and apoptosis. Suggesting that PLK2 overexpression could potentially be leveraged as a therapeutic strategy to inhibit tumor progression and enhance apoptosis, providing new ...

Establishment and biological characterization of radioresistant colorectal cancer cell lines

open access: yesFEBS Open Bio, EarlyView.
Under ionizing radiation exposure, radiation‐sensitive cancer cells exhibit oxidative stress and DNA damage, while radiation‐resistant cancer cells exhibit strong antioxidant properties and DNA damage repair. Radiotherapy resistance is a major cause of recurrence and metastasis in colorectal cancer (CRC).
